Cupra Ateca  is nice, a little quicker than a GTI. Seem to be some good deals on them too

Seat/Cupra need to sort their marketing out. If you try and configure a Cupra Leon ST, you get an image of the car with a Seat badge on the bonnet/boot.... The Ateca looks to have it right, to be fair. It ain't quite Toyota/Lexus (yet).

The current Cupra does have a Seat badge, doesn't it?

The next iteration won't

Yes, the current Leon Cupra is still badged as a Seat - albeit the colour of the Seat logo on the front grille, tailgate, steering wheel and the centre caps of the wheels are now copper coloured rather than chrome.
